What is the Derivatives Exam?

The CIRO Derivatives Exam is a proficiency requirement for investment professionals who want to advise on or trade derivative products including options, futures, and structured products in Canada.

Derivatives Exam Structure

  • Duration: 3 hours
  • Questions: 120 multiple-choice questions
  • Passing Score: Determined by CIRO for each exam sitting
  • Prerequisites: RSE or ISE completion

Key Topics Covered

1. Options Fundamentals

Call and put options, option pricing, Greeks (Delta, Gamma, Theta, Vega), intrinsic and time value.

2. Futures Contracts

Futures mechanics, margin requirements, settlement procedures, hedging strategies.

3. Trading Strategies

Covered calls, protective puts, spreads, straddles, strangles, collars.

4. Risk Management

Portfolio hedging, risk assessment, margin calculations, position sizing.

5. Regulatory Framework

CIRO rules for derivatives trading, suitability requirements, disclosure obligations.

Study Tips for Derivatives Exam

  • Master the basics before tackling complex strategies
  • Practice calculations—many questions involve math
  • Understand payoff diagrams for all strategies
  • Focus on regulatory requirements and suitability
  • Use mock exams to simulate test conditions
